Message type: E = Error
Message class: DB02 - For Oracle Component of the Database Monitor
Message number: 146
Message text: New 'brconnect -f check' results are currently not available.

The SAP error message DB02146, which states "New 'brconnect -f check' results are currently not available," typically relates to issues with the database connectivity or the database tools used for managing the SAP database. This error can occur in various scenarios, particularly when using the BR*Tools for database administration.
Cause: Database Connectivity Issues: The error may arise if there are problems connecting to the database, such as network issues, incorrect database parameters, or database service not running. *BRTools Version Mismatch*: If the version of BRTools is not compatible with the database version, it may lead to this error. Database Lock or Corruption: If the database is locked or if there is corruption in the database files, the BR*Tools may not be able to retrieve the necessary information. Insufficient Permissions: The user executing the command may not have the necessary permissions to perform the check.
